Brief description Flugplatz Bienenfarm Gmbh

Oldtimer-Flugplatz Bienenfarm is a historic airfield west of Berlin in Havelland, Brandenburg. It focuses on flying historic aircraft, scenic flights, pilot training, and regular aviation events.

Visitors can see the QUAX hangar exhibition, enjoy the beer garden and restaurant, and watch active oldtimer aircraft in operation. Pilots find grass-strip operations, charter options, hangar space, and overnight stays.

Where is Oldtimer-Flugplatz Bienenfarm located?
Oldtimer-Flugplatz Bienenfarm is in Brandenburg, Germany, about 30 km west of Berlin near Nauen, in the Havelland region. The airfield is close to Paulinenaue and the Ortsteil Bienenfarm, with ICAO code EDOI. Its website also describes it as being at the road between Berge and Paulinenaue. How much does flight training at Oldtimer-Flugplatz Bienenfarm cost?
No public training price list was found for Oldtimer-Flugplatz Bienenfarm. The site does publish some pilot-related fees, such as hangar service at 10 EUR per use day and monthly parking rates from 75 EUR to 360 EUR depending on aircraft size, but these are not training costs. What aircraft does Oldtimer-Flugplatz Bienenfarm use for training and flying?
The airfield is focused on historic aviation and mentions flying old biplanes, a 1950s Cessna, and modern ultralight aircraft for sightseeing flights. It also says many aircraft are permanently based there, including vintage types, but it does not publish a full training fleet list on the pages reviewed.
